Discover top Tangier attractions
Tangier, a vibrant city where the Mediterranean meets the Atlantic, offers travelers a rich tapestry of history and culture to explore. Begin your adventure at the Kasbah, a historic fortress with breathtaking views over the bay and the city, where you can roam through narrow alleys lined with artisan shops and local cafes. Don’t miss the American Legation Museum, a unique cultural site that highlights the city’s long-standing relationship with the United States, showcasing art and artifacts from the 19th century. For a taste of local life, visit the bustling Grand Socco, where markets brim with spices, textiles, and traditional Moroccan goods—perfect for picking up unique souvenirs. Families will enjoy a day at the sandy beaches of Plage de Tanger, where you can soak up the sun or indulge in various water sports. As the sun sets, take a stroll along the scenic Corniche, where the sound of waves and the aroma of fresh seafood from nearby restaurants create a delightful atmosphere.
